Sony Electronics Introduces the New FE 70-200 F2.8 GM OSS II

Sony Electronics Inc. announced the newest lens in their G Master lineup – the FE 70-200mm F2.8 GM OSS II, which delivers an extraordinary combination of resolution and bokeh as well as unequalled AF (autofocus) performance known to Sony’s G Master design.

Designed to perfectly pair with Sony’s E-mount camera bodies, the FE 70-200mm F2.8 GM OSS II not only offers outstanding optical quality and advanced AF performance, but it is the lightest F2.8 70-200mm zoom in the world and allows for unprecedented shooting freedom and flexibility. Sony continues to strengthen the Alpha system with this newest addition to the broadest selection of mirrorless lenses on the market as the 65th lens in its E-mount lens lineup.

The new FE 70-200mm F2.8 GM OSS II delivers outstanding image quality with high resolution and clarity. Users can expect a clean and clear image from corner to corner throughout the entire zoom range, even when the aperture is wide open. Thanks to the two aspherical lens elements, including one XA (extreme aspherical) element manufactured to 0.01-micron surface precision, the FE 70-200mm F2.8 GM OSS II effectively controls distance-related aberration variations to ensure outstanding resolution throughout the image area.

The FE 70-200mm F2.8 GM OSS II also employs two ED (extra-low dispersion) spherical glass elements and two Super ED spherical glass elements to significantly reduce chromatic aberration without color bleeding. This lens also includes an ED aspherical element for the first time in an Alpha system lens, which simultaneously suppresses chromatic and spherical aberration, common issues in other telephoto lenses.

Smooth, beautiful bokeh is made possible by a large F2.8 maximum aperture and a newly developed 11-blade circular aperture unit. In addition, the lens’ advanced optical design including an XA element thoroughly suppresses the unwanted ‘onion ring’ effect, further enhancing the bokeh. The FE 70-200mm F2.8 GM OSS II also offers excellent close-up performance with deep bokeh. The minimum focusing distance is just 15.7 inches (0.4 meters) at 70mm and 32.3 inches (0.82 meters) at 200mm, with a maximum magnification of 0.3x. Moreover, the FE 70-200mm F2.8 GM OSS II can be easily paired with Sony’s high-performance 1.4x or 2.0x teleconverter to extend the lens’ focal length to 400mmiv at an F5.6 aperture, all while maintaining its G Master quality.

To avoid any unwanted flare and ghosting in challenging lighting conditions, Sony’s original Nano AR Coating II produces a uniform anti-reflection coating on the surface of the lens. In addition, the FE 70-200mm F2.8 GM OSS II’s optical design also effectively suppresses internal reflections to improve clarity.

The FE 70-200mm F2.8 GM OSS II’s state-of-the-art lens technology brings out the best in the advanced camera body it is paired with. The new lens uses four Sony-original XD (extreme dynamic) Linear Motors for extraordinary fast and precise AF, making it up to approximately four times faster and with focus tracking improved by 30% when compared to the previous model. When paired with Sony’s flagship Alpha 1, the FE 70-200mm F2.8 GM OSS II is capable of high-speed continuous shooting at up to 30 fps. Superb AF tracking is also available even when using a teleconverter. For video, the FE 70-200mm F2.8 GM OSS II offers smooth and quiet AF to reliably lock in focus and track fast-moving subjects, even while zooming, so the user can leave the focusing to the camera.

The new FE 70-200mm F2.8 GM OSS II will be available in December for approximately $2,800.00 USD and $3,500.00 CAD. It will be sold at a variety of Sony’s authorized dealers throughout North America.
